Understanding the Cost: Fixed Prices for Peace of Mind

One of the primary concerns for any traveller is the cost, and we believe in complete transparency. Our private taxi service from Heathrow to Oxford operates on a fixed-price model, ensuring you won't encounter any surprises or unexpected charges upon arrival. This commitment to clarity allows you to plan your budget meticulously, free from the worries of fluctuating meter rates or additional fees.

For an executive saloon vehicle, such as a comfortable Mercedes E Class, the cost of a private transfer from Heathrow to Oxford is set at £105. This price includes a premium meet and greet service, where your driver will be waiting for you inside the airport's arrivals area with a sign displaying your name. This vehicle is perfectly suited for up to 3 passengers, comfortably accommodating 2 large suitcases and 2 carry-on bags. Should you require a slightly more economical option without compromising on quality, a standard saloon (Mercedes E Class) is available for £98.00, capable of carrying 4 passengers, 2 hand luggage, and 2 check-in luggage.

For larger groups or those travelling with more luggage, our Mercedes Viano people carrier provides an ideal solution. This spacious vehicle is suitable for up to 6 passengers, along with 6 large suitcases and 6 carry-on bags. The cost for a private transfer in a Mercedes Viano people carrier from Heathrow to Oxford is £165. Your Seamless Airport Pick-Up: Meeting Your Driver at Heathrow

Our meet and greet service is designed to make your arrival at Heathrow as smooth as possible. When you pre-book your private taxi, your driver will be waiting for you inside the arrivals terminal, holding a sign clearly displaying your name. This eliminates any confusion or wasted time searching for your transport.

The exact meeting point at Heathrow depends on which terminal you arrive at. This specific information will be detailed in your booking confirmation, ensuring you know exactly where to go. However, for your convenience, here are the general meeting points:

  • Heathrow Airport Terminal 2 To Oxford Taxi: The driver will meet passengers in the arrivals hall in front of the WH Smith shop.
  • Heathrow Airport Terminal 3 To Oxford Taxi: The driver will meet passengers in the arrivals hall in front of the WH Smith shop.
  • Heathrow Airport Terminal 4 To Oxford Taxi: The driver will meet passengers in the arrivals hall in front of the Costa Coffee shop.
  • Heathrow Airport Terminal 5 To Oxford Taxi: The driver will meet passengers in the arrivals hall in front of the Costa Coffee shop.

What if My Flight is Delayed or Cancelled?

We understand that flight schedules can be unpredictable. That's why, when you book, we ask for your arrival flight details. This flight number allows us to track your flight's status in real-time. In the event of a delay, we will automatically reschedule your driver's pick-up time at no extra charge. You won't incur any additional fees for delayed flights, providing you with complete peace of mind. Should your flight be cancelled entirely, we offer the flexibility of either a full refund or a reschedule for your new arrival date and time, whichever suits your needs best.

How long will a Heathrow to Oxford taxi journey take?

The average journey time from Heathrow Airport to Oxford is approximately 1 hour, covering a distance of about 45 miles (72.1 Kms). Please note that journey times can be slightly longer during peak rush hour periods, which typically occur between 7 am and 9 am in the morning and between 4 pm and 6 pm in the evening.
